Soccer legends descend on Durban

Liverpool Legends take on Kaizer Chiefs Legends at Moses Mabhida Stadium on Saturday 16 November 2013.

DURBAN is in for a real treat when some of the greatest names in the history of Liverpool Football Club lock horns with Kaizer Chiefs legends in an exhibition match at Moses Mabhida Stadium on Saturday 16 November at 2pm (kickoff).

The match is a culmination of the three-day tour of KZN, and forms part of the Liverpool Legends 5Times South Africa Tour 2013. The tour includes a golf day at the Zimbali Country Club on Wednesday 13 November, a gala dinner on Thursday 14 November, as well as coaching clinics and autograph signing sessions for fans to meet their heroes off the pitch.

The Liverpool Legends side will be packed with European champions and some of the top names in the club’s history, covering the glory period from the 1960s through to the last decade.

The likes of former defender Phil Neal, who won an astonishing 22 medals during his time at Anfield, former Kop favourite and England international John Barnes, twin strike sensations John Aldridge and Robbie Fowler as well as Durban born goalkeeper Bruce Grobbelaar, are just some of the top players who will be part of the tour.

John Barnes said it was an honour to play in front of passionate fans and show some of the skills that not only won Liverpool many trophies but millions of friends around the world too.

“We have a great respect for the Kaizer Chiefs club, who are SA’s most successful team. They too have had many great players down the years and we look forward to locking horns with them,” said Barnes.

Kaizer Chiefs have called upon great names in the club’s history such as Doctor Khumalo, Lucas Radebe, John ‘Shoes’ Moshoeu and Neil Tovey.

Kaizer Chiefs legend Doctor Khumalo said the team had some great players in its history and for those that never saw them play in their prime, this would be a wonderful opportunity to show the younger fans the skills that made these players such legends.

Liverpool was formed in 1892 and won 18 English League titles, seven FA Cups, and are five-time European Champions.
